Account
People Popularity Rank
of 4.6M people
Acting (Chester Dunlap) · Director · Writer · Director of Photography · Editor
Acting (Narrator) · Director · Writer
Acting (Bloody Worker) · Director · Writer
Director of Photography · Director · Editor · Writer · Producer · Production Design · Weapons Master · Makeup Artist
Director